Types of Headphones
Headphones can be classified based on their style, technology, and features. Below is a breakdown of the different types available in the UK:
Type | Description | Ideal For |
---|---|---|
Over-ear | Large cushions that cover the entire ear | Audiophiles, home listening |
On-ear | Smaller sized cushions that rest on the ear | Casual listeners, portability |
In-ear | Little earbuds that fit straight into the ear canal | Active usage, travelling |
Wireless | Link by means of Bluetooth, no cables included | Convenience, movement |
Noise-Cancelling | Lowers ambient sound for an immersive experience | Travellers, office employees |
Sports | Created for active wear, typically sweat-resistant | Physical fitness lovers, commuters |
Over-Ear Headphones
Over-ear headphones are often thought about the gold standard for audio quality. They offer excellent sound seclusion and convenience, making them ideal for long listening sessions. Popular brands like Sennheiser and Sony deal superior designs that are highly ranked for their sound efficiency.
On-Ear Headphones
On-ear headphones are light-weight and typically more portable than their over-ear counterparts. They suit casual listeners who desire a balance in between sound quality and portability. Brands like Beats and Bose deal several compelling options in this classification.
In-Ear Headphones
In-ear headphones, frequently understood as earbuds, are highly portable and typically featured active sound cancellation functions. They are preferred by users who choose a compact design, making them easy to carry around. Brand names such as Apple's AirPods and Samsung's Galaxy Buds are especially popular in the UK.
Wireless Headphones

Noise-Cancelling Headphones
Noise-cancelling headphones are increasingly chosen, particularly by frequent tourists. These headphones can substantially improve the listening experience by lowering background sound. Brands like Bose and Sony lead this niche, offering extraordinary products for those seeking tranquility in loud environments.
Sports Headphones
Sports headphones are tailored for active people. They typically feature sweat-resistant functions and a comfortable fit to remain in place during workouts. Brands such as JBL and Jaybird design headphones that cater particularly to physical fitness enthusiasts.
Existing Trends in the UK Headphone Market
The headphone market in the UK is ever-evolving, affected by technological developments and consumer demand. Some current patterns consist of:
- Increased Demand for Wireless Models: With smartphones getting rid of headphone jacks, customers are gravitating towards wireless alternatives for higher convenience.
- Personalization and Personalization: Many brand names are now providing adjustable sound profiles, allowing users to tailor their listening experience.
- Focus on Sustainability: A growing number of brands are devoting to eco-friendly practices, developing items from recycled materials and using sustainable product packaging.
- Integration of Smart Features: Features like voice assistants and touch controls are ending up being requirement in numerous contemporary headphones.
Factors To Consider When Buying Headphones
When acquiring headphones, customers ought to take a number of elements into account to ensure they are making the best choice for their needs:
- Purpose: Identify the primary usage, whether for casual listening, commuting, gaming, or professional audio work.
- Sound Quality: Consider frequency reaction, sound signature, and whether you prefer bass-heavy or balanced noise.
- Comfort: Determine the fit and comfort based upon the type of headphone. Over-ear designs may be preferable for long listening sessions, while in-ear variations might be much better for active usage.
- Battery Life: For wireless designs, battery life is crucial. Search for choices with longer playback times.
- Price: Establish a spending plan, as there is a wide variety in prices based upon brand and technology.
